在Linux平台上,无论编写客户端程序还是服务端程序,在进行高并发TCP连接处理时,最高的并发数量都要受到系统对用户单一进程同时可打开文件数量的限制(这是因为系统为每个TCP连接都要创建一个socket句柄,每个socket句柄同时也是一个文件句柄)。
2021-10-19 17:00:37 96KB socket Linux 高并发编程 ulimit
1
超限 有助于管理ulimit配置的角色。 例子 --- # Example of how to use the role - hosts: myhost vars: ulimit_config: - domain: '*' type: soft item: core value: 0 - domain: '*' type: hard item: rss value: 10000 roles: - ulimit 角色变量 角色使用的变量列表: # Default ulimit configuration ulimit_config: [] # Default limits.conf location ulimit_config_location
2021-09-28 17:34:50 3KB
1